Active Real Estate Investing Strategies

Buy and Hold

When a real estate investor purchases an investment property and keeps it for a prolonged period, it is thought to be a Buy and Hold investment. As a property is being held, it is usually rented or leased, to maximize returns.

At some point in the future, when the value of the investment property has increased, the investor has the advantage of liquidating the investment property if that is to their benefit.

Price to rent ratio

Price to rent ratio (p/r) is determined by dividing the median property price by the yearly median gross rent. A community with high rental rates should have a low p/r. The higher rent you can collect, the faster you can repay your investment. You don’t want a p/r that is low enough it makes purchasing a house preferable to renting one. If tenants are turned into purchasers, you might get stuck with unused rental units. However, lower p/r ratios are typically more acceptable than high ratios.

Long Term Rental (BRRRR)

BRRRR stands for “Buy, Rehab, Rent, Refinance, Repeat”. BRRRR is a strategy for consistent expansion. This plan rests on your capability to remove cash out when you refinance.

When you have concluded rehabbing the asset, its market value should be higher than your complete purchase and fix-up costs. The rental is refinanced using the ARV and the difference, or equity, comes to you in cash. You acquire your next property with the cash-out money and start anew. You add income-producing investment assets to your balance sheet and lease income to your cash flow.

Short-Term Rental Cash-on-Cash Return

To know if you should put your cash in a certain investment asset or region, compute the cash-on-cash return. Divide the Net Operating Income (NOI) by the total amount of cash put in. The percentage you get is your cash-on-cash return. High cash-on-cash return means that you will get back your cash more quickly and the investment will earn more profit. Financed ventures will have a higher cash-on-cash return because you will be spending less of your cash.

Average Short-Term Rental Capitalization (Cap) Rates

One metric indicates the market value of real estate as a return-yielding asset — average short-term rental capitalization (cap) rate. High cap rates mean that rental units are accessible in that area for fair prices. When cap rates are low, you can expect to spend more for investment properties in that location. Divide your estimated Net Operating Income (NOI) by the property’s value or purchase price. The percentage you get is the property’s cap rate.

Wholesaling

Wholesaling is a real estate investment strategy that requires scouting out houses that are desirable to investors and signing a sale and purchase agreement. However you don’t buy the home: after you have the property under contract, you get a real estate investor to become the buyer for a fee. The contracted property is bought by the real estate investor, not the wholesaler. The real estate wholesaler doesn’t sell the property under contract itself — they just sell the purchase and sale agreement.

Mortgage Note Investing

Acquiring mortgage notes (loans) works when the loan can be bought for a lower amount than the remaining balance. By doing so, the investor becomes the lender to the original lender’s client.

When a loan is being repaid on time, it is thought of as a performing loan. Performing loans provide stable cash flow for investors. Some note investors look for non-performing notes because when they can’t successfully rework the mortgage, they can always purchase the property at foreclosure for a below market amount.

Foreclosure Laws

Successful mortgage note investors are completely knowledgeable about their state’s laws concerning foreclosure. Some states require mortgage paperwork and some use Deeds of Trust. A mortgage requires that the lender goes to court for approval to start foreclosure. You don’t need the court’s approval with a Deed of Trust.

Mortgage Interest Rates

Note investors take over the interest rate of the mortgage loan notes that they buy. Your mortgage note investment return will be influenced by the interest rate. Interest rates influence the strategy of both types of note investors.

Conventional lenders charge dissimilar mortgage loan interest rates in different parts of the US. The stronger risk accepted by private lenders is shown in higher interest rates for their loans compared to conventional loans.

Mortgage note investors ought to consistently be aware of the current market mortgage interest rates, private and traditional, in potential mortgage note investment markets.

Property Values

The more equity that a homebuyer has in their property, the better it is for you as the mortgage note owner. If the investor has to foreclose on a loan with lacking equity, the sale might not even cover the balance invested in the note. The combined effect of mortgage loan payments that lower the loan balance and yearly property market worth growth increases home equity.

Property Taxes

Escrows for real estate taxes are most often given to the mortgage lender along with the mortgage loan payment. When the taxes are payable, there needs to be adequate funds in escrow to pay them. The mortgage lender will have to make up the difference if the mortgage payments cease or the lender risks tax liens on the property. Tax liens leapfrog over all other liens.

If an area has a record of rising property tax rates, the combined home payments in that municipality are steadily growing. Borrowers who have difficulty handling their loan payments might drop farther behind and eventually default.

Passive Real Estate Investing Strategies

Syndications

A syndication means an organization of investors who gather their capital and talents to invest in real estate. The syndication is organized by a person who enrolls other professionals to participate in the venture.

The individual who arranges the Syndication is referred to as the Sponsor or the Syndicator. The Syndicator oversees all real estate details including buying or building assets and supervising their operation. They are also in charge of distributing the promised revenue to the other partners.

The members in a syndication invest passively. The partnership promises to pay them a preferred return when the investments are turning a profit. These owners have no obligations concerned with supervising the syndication or handling the operation of the assets.

Ownership Interest

The Syndication is fully owned by all the owners. Everyone who puts money into the company should expect to own more of the company than partners who do not.

Being a capital investor, you should also intend to be given a preferred return on your capital before income is split. Preferred return is a percentage of the capital invested that is distributed to cash investors out of profits. All the shareholders are then paid the rest of the profits determined by their percentage of ownership.

When company assets are sold, profits, if any, are paid to the partners. The combined return on a deal like this can definitely increase when asset sale net proceeds are combined with the yearly revenues from a successful project. The syndication’s operating agreement outlines the ownership arrangement and how everyone is dealt with financially.

REITs

A REIT, or Real Estate Investment Trust, means a company that invests in income-producing properties. Before REITs appeared, real estate investing was considered too expensive for many people. Shares in REITs are economical for most investors.

Shareholders’ involvement in a REIT is passive investment. Investment risk is spread throughout a package of investment properties. Participants have the capability to sell their shares at any moment. However, REIT investors do not have the option to choose specific investment properties or markets. Their investment is limited to the properties selected by their REIT.

Real Estate Investment Funds

Real estate investment funds are basically mutual funds concentrating on real estate companies, including REITs. Any actual property is held by the real estate firms rather than the fund. This is an additional way for passive investors to diversify their portfolio with real estate avoiding the high entry-level expense or exposure. Funds are not obligated to pay dividends unlike a REIT. As with other stocks, investment funds’ values go up and drop with their share value.

Investors are able to choose a fund that focuses on particular segments of the real estate industry but not particular locations for each real estate investment. You have to depend on the fund’s directors to select which markets and real estate properties are chosen for investment.
